Density Matrix Theories in Quantum Physics
More LessIn Density Matrix Theories in Quantum Physics, the author explores new possibilities for the main quantities in quantum physics – the statistical operator and the density matrix. The starting point in this exploration is the Lindblad equation for the statistical operator, where the main element of influence on a system by its environment is the dissipative operator. Bondarev has developed the theory of the harmonic oscillator, in which he finds the density matrix and proves the Heisenberg relation. Bondarev has written the dissipative diffusion and attenuation operators and proven the equivalence of the Wigner and Fokker–Planck equations using them. He further develops theories of the light-emitting diode and ball lightning. Bondarev also derives equations for the density matrix of a single particle and a system of identical particles. These equations have a remarkable property: when the density matrix has a diagonal shape they turn into a quantum kinetic equation for probability. Additional chapters in the book present new theories of experimentally discovered phenomena, such as the step kinetics of bimolecular reactions in solids, superconductivity, superfluidity, the energy spectrum of an arbitrary atom, lasers, spasers, and graphene.
Density Matrix Theories in Quantum Physics is an informative reference for theoretical physicists interested in new theories on the subject of complex physical phenomena, quantum theory and density matrices.

Development and Application of Biomedical Titanium Alloys
More LessTitanium and its alloys have been widely used as biomedical implant materials due to their low density, good mechanical properties, superior corrosion resistance and biocompatibility when compared with other metallic biomaterials such as CoCr alloys and stainless steels. Recently, β-type titanium alloys have been increasingly considered as excellent implant materials because of the remarkable combination of high strength-to-weight ratio, good fatigue resistance, relatively low Young's modulus, good biocompatibility and high corrosion resistance relative to conventional titanium biomaterials.
This book covers recent information about biomedical titanium alloy development and 3D printing. Chapters describe the processing, microstructure, mechanical properties and corrosion properties in detail. Information about the surface modification of titanium alloys for biomedical applications, and manufacturing of titanium alloys by new technologies (such as selective laser melting and electron beam melting), is also presented. Readers will learn about the various types of biomedical titanium alloys, their advantages and disadvantages, their fabrication methods and medical applications.
This book is a useful handbook for biomedical engineers, metallurgists and biotechnicians seeking information about titanium-based alloys for biomaterials research and development.

Developmental and Stem Cell Biology in Health and Disease
More LessResearch into stem cells started in the 1960s with experiments on spleen cultures. Evans and Kaufman made a breakthrough in mouse embryo culturing and embryonic stem cell extraction in 1981, followed by the work of Thomson in 1998 on the technique for extracting human embryonic stem cells. Since then, stem cell research has rapidly expanded as a therapeutic avenue for different diseases in humans. This book explains the basic developmental biology of stem cells including the development of stem cells during the implantation stage in utero to the regulation of stem cell division. Medical applications of stem cells in the therapy of diseases such as cancer, neurodegenerative diseases, and bone diseases are also explained in subsequent chapters. The book also explains the effect of parasitic cells on stem cell growth. Concepts in the book are explained in a simple clear manner, making this book an informative reference for non-experts, students and professionals in the field of biology and medicine.

Dimorphic Fungi: Their Importance as Models for Differentiation and Fungal Pathogenesis
More LessDimorphism can be defined as the property of different fungal species to grow in the form of budding yeasts or in the form of mycelium, depending on the environmental conditions. Dimorphism may be considered as a differentiative phenomenon, similar to others exhibited by fungi: spore germination, sporulation, etc, but comparatively simple to analyze.
Fungal dimorphism involves extensive changes in the cell physiology and morphology in response to external signals, producing drastic alterations in the cell wall structure and synthesis, whose growth pattern changes from isodiametric (spherical) to polarized or vice versa. Because of this, dimorphism has been the subject of extensive studies as a model for the differentiation processes occurring in eukaryotic organisms.
Additionally, it is important to recall that the most important human pathogenic fungi, and some plant pathogenic ones are dimorphic, displaying different morphologies when growing as saprophytes, or inside their hosts. This observation, and the demonstration that mutants in specific genes that interfere with the dimorphic transition are non-virulent, has suggested that this process might be a target for efficient antimycotic drugs.
This e-book includes several chapters on the most important and studied fungal models, written by specialists, discussing the biology of each species or genera, the general aspects controlling their dimorphic transition, the molecular aspects involved, the use of them as models for understanding the bases of biochemical and cell differentiation, and the importance of dimorphism in pathogenesis.
This e-book is recommended for scholars and researchers working or interested in human, animal and plant pathogenesis, fungal genetics, molecular biology, development, evolution, and differentiation.

Echography in Ocular Pathology
More LessThis monograph expands on the ultrasound exploration of the ocular globe (or, in other words, the human eye) with a review of the current knowledge about ocular ultrasound techniques and its indications in ophthalmic pathology. Ocular echography has only been recently studied in greater detail by ophthalmologists thanks to new imaging techniques such as optical coherence tomography [OCT] and scanning lasers, which have become the preference in ocular exploration, relegating ultrasound to cases with poor fundus visualization. New ultrasound equipment with multi-frequency linear probes between 15 to 18 MHz, also permits technicians to observe ocular structures with greater detail. A key aspect of ultrasound is its dynamic capability, which allows assessing the displacement of intraocular structures and their relation to the different eye layers. This is crucial in diagnosing retina pathologies that can affect the outcome of cataract surgery. Ocular echography is also an excellent option to determine retinal lesions in cases of ocular tumors (choroid melanoma) as it is also a differential diagnosis for other tumors (metastasic tumors or hemangiomas). The book also includes a chapter on the use of Color-Doppler ocular examinations in the diagnosis of ocular vasculopathies (arterial or venous occlusions).
Echography in Ocular Pathology empowers readers ophthalmologists and clinical technicians with the knowledge to diagnose different eye pathologies and thus ameliorate ophthalmic patient management.

Electrochemical Biosensors in Practice: Material and Methods
More LessA biosensor is an integrated receptor-transducer device that converts a biological response into an electrical signal. The design and development of biosensors have taken center stage for researchers or scientists in the recent decade owing to the wide range of biosensor applications in healthcare and disease diagnosis, environmental monitoring, water and food quality, and drug delivery. Due to their adaptability, ease of use in relatively complex samples, and portability, the significance of electrochemical biosensors in analytical chemistry has increased manifold. Electrochemistry has been pivotal in developing transduction methods for biological processes and biosensors. In parallel, the explosion of activity in nanoscience and nanotechnology and their huge success have profoundly affected biosensor technology, opening new avenues of research for electrode materials and transduction.
Electrochemical Biosensors in Practice: Material and Methods particularly explores the use of silver and gold nanoparticles for signal amplification, photocurrent transduction, and aptamer design. Therefore, the book serves as an introductory text for those specializing in biosensors and bioelectronics and their practical applications.

Emerging Chagas Disease
More LessThe book focuses on a global problem challenging the health systems. Trypanosoma cruzi infections are transmitted by cone-nosed triatomine bugs, by blood transfusion and congenitally from mothers to their offspring. The American Trypanosomiasis affects 20 million people; among them a significant parcel (< 1/3) will develop Chagas disease in the heart and digestive tract, where the immune system effector cells destroy target host cells. Genotype modifications resulting from transfer of minicircle sequence kDNA from the parasite into the host´s genome may explain the autoimmune pathogenesis of the disease. The book discusses various aspects of this disease and should be of interest to readers who wish to keep abreast of the developments in this field.
